Infrastructure to detect sleep-inside-spinlock bugs. Really only
useful if compiled with CONFIG_PREEMPT=y. It prints out a whiny
message and a stack backtrace if someone calls a function which might
sleep from within an atomic region.
This patch generates a storm of output at boot, due to
drivers/ide/ide-probe.c:init_irq() calling lots of things which it
shouldn't under ide_lock.
It'll find other bugs too.

--- 2.5.38/kernel/sched.c~might_sleep Wed Sep 25 20:15:27 2002
+++ 2.5.38-akpm/kernel/sched.c Wed Sep 25 20:15:28 2002
@@ -2150,3 +2150,20 @@ void __init sched_init(void)
enter_lazy_tlb(&init_mm, current, smp_processor_id());
}
+#ifdef CONFIG_DEBUG_KERNEL
+void __might_sleep(char *file, int line)
+{
+#if defined(in_atomic)
+ static unsigned long prev_jiffy; /* ratelimiting */
+
+ if (in_atomic()) {
+ if (time_before(jiffies, prev_jiffy + HZ))
+ return;
+ prev_jiffy = jiffies;
+ printk("Sleeping function called from illegal"
+ " context at %s:%d\n", file, line);
+ dump_stack();
+ }
+#endif
+}
+#endif
